What this means

This registration is in, or will soon enter, a USPTO maintenance window. Missing a Section 8 or Section 9 filing can cancel the registration.

Status 700: Status 700 means the trademark is registered and active on the Principal Register. You have nationwide rights for the listed goods and services and may use ®. Section 8 maintenance is due between years five and six.

Goods and services

ClassDescriptionStatusFirst use
035Incubation services, namely, providing office facilities in the nature of individual workspace containing business equipment to existing businesses and individualsACTIVE
043Hotel accommodation services; Hotel services; resort lodging services; provision of general purpose facilities for meetings, conferences and exhibitions; provision of banqueting and social function facilities for special occasions; and reservation service for hotel accommodations for others, namely, reservation of hotel rooms for travelersACTIVE
